Bhubaneswar, July 14 (IANS) A Fast Track Special Court in Odisha’s Jagatsinghpur district on Tuesday sentenced three persons to 20 years of rigorous imprisonment in connection with a gangrape case reported in the Tirtol area of the district in 2024. The three convicts were awarded rigorous imprisonment under Sections 376D and 506 of the Indian Penal Code (IPC). Bhubaneswar, May 27 (IANS) The Election Commission of India (ECI) on Wednesday announced the schedule for the by-elections to fill the vacancy in the Rajya Sabha from Odisha following the resignation of Debashish Samantaray.Samantaray resigned on Monday from the BJD and the Rajya Sabha.According to the schedule announced by the ECI on Wednesday, the notification for the by-election will be issued on June 1.
